When Jesus says to "call no man father" in Matthew 23:9, He was not speaking literally. In the Scriptures, we see the Apostles John and Paul referring to themselves and priests as fathers (1 Corinthians 4:15 and 1 John 2:13-14).
They were not disobeying or ignoring Our Lord's commands—they clearly understood what Jesus meant and made sure their disciples and the early Church understood as well.
